首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

php if语句导致文件写入两次

PHP if语句导致文件写入两次是由于if语句的条件判断出现了问题,导致代码块中的文件写入操作被执行了两次。这可能是由于条件判断的逻辑错误或者代码中的逻辑错误导致的。

为了解决这个问题,可以按照以下步骤进行排查和修复:

  1. 检查if语句的条件判断逻辑:确保条件判断的表达式和预期一致,避免出现逻辑错误。可以使用var_dump()或echo语句输出条件判断的结果,以便确认条件判断是否符合预期。
  2. 检查代码块中的文件写入操作:确认文件写入操作是否正确放置在if语句的代码块中,并且没有其他地方重复执行了相同的文件写入操作。
  3. 检查代码中的逻辑错误:仔细检查代码中是否存在其他可能导致文件写入两次的逻辑错误,例如循环中的重复执行、函数调用的错误等。
  4. 使用调试工具:可以使用调试工具(如Xdebug)来跟踪代码的执行流程,以便更好地定位问题所在。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云云服务器(CVM):提供可扩展的云服务器实例,适用于各种应用场景。产品介绍链接
  • 腾讯云对象存储(COS):提供安全、稳定、低成本的云端存储服务,适用于存储和管理大量非结构化数据。产品介绍链接
  • 腾讯云云函数(SCF):无服务器计算服务,可帮助开发者更轻松地构建和运行云端应用程序。产品介绍链接

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和项目要求进行评估。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

31分41秒

【玩转 WordPress】腾讯云serverless搭建WordPress个人博经验分享

领券